Nature
The George Bähr circular hiking trail passes through Fürstenwalde. The themed circular hiking trail is approximately 13.91 kilometers long and of moderate difficulty. It connects landscapes of the Ore Mountains, forests, and historic sites; information boards along the route are dedicated to George Bähr.
Fürstenwalde is situated away from major traffic routes and is a place for peaceful walks and bicycle tours, secluded spots, and expansive views.

Culture
The local history includes mining, the former hammer mill, now known as Hammerschänke, as well as memorials to George Bähr. He was born in the village and is regarded as the builder of Dresden Frauenkirche.
Geographical Setting
The surrounding area of Fürstenwalde includes Osterzgebirge Wildlife Park, Wittigschloß, Hrad Kysperk, Scharspitze, Kahleberg, and Bouřňák.
The wider regional area around Fürstenwalde includes Hrad Střekov and Weesenstein Castle.
